Chicago — Singer R. Kelly, already facing sexual abuse charges brought by Illinois prosecutors, was arrested in Chicago Thursday on a federal grand jury indictment listing 13 counts including sex crimes and obstruction of justice. U.S. Attorney’s office spokesman Joseph Fitzpatrick said the R&B singer was taken into custody about 7 p.m. local time and was being held by federal authorities. He was arrested after the federal indictment was handed down earlier Thursday in federal court for the Northern District of Illinois. “The counts include child porn, enticement of a minor and obstruction of justice,” Fitzpatrick said, adding that further details would be released Friday.

An extensive blackout struck Manhattan on Saturday night as power was lost in Midtown, Hells Kitchen and the Upper West Side. Street lights were reported knocked out on Columbus Ave. on the Upper West Side, and a power outage was also reported in Rockefeller Center around 7 p.m. “We are responding to extensive outages on the west side of Manhattan,” said Con Ed spokesman Michael Clendenin. “It’s equipment issues, and we are working to restore customers,” Clendenin said. More than 42,000 Con Ed customers had lost electricity by around 8 p.m. Clendenin didn’t know how long the power might be out.

New Yorkers crowded the city's already busy streets on Friday evening to catch of glimpse of the year's second - and final - Manhattanhenge.The term, coined by astrophysicist Neil deGrasse Tyson in 2002, describes a phenomenon that occurs when 'when the setting sun aligns precisely with the Manhattan street grid, creating a radiant glow of light across Manhattan's brick and steel canyons, simultaneously illuminating both the north and south sides of every cross street of the borough's grid.'Looking down the street on Friday, people were able to view a full sun hovering just above the horizon. The House voted Friday to prevent President Trump from going to war with Iran without congressional approval, after more than two dozen Republicans joined Democrats to include the provision in the House’s annual defense authorization bill. The move sets up a showdown with the Senate over whether the Iran restriction, which includes an exception for cases of self-defense, will be included in the final bill negotiated between the two chambers.

The Trump administration scored its first judicial win in its long-running battle to punish so-called sanctuary cities for defying federal immigration laws.A three-judge panel on the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als overturned a nationwide injunction barring Department of Justice from rewarding cities and counties that cooperate with US Immigration and Customs Enforcement in deportations.Los Angeles officials had sued to stop the DOJ’s Community Oriented Policing Services (COPS) program, saying that it amounted to federal coercion.But in a 2-1 decision, the court found that the Trump administration has a right to reward behavior that it favors.

WASHINGTON–The wait for former special counsel Robert Mueller's long-anticipated public testimony got a little longer Friday. Mueller's planned July 17 appearances before the House Judiciary and Intelligence Committees has been postponed for one week to allow more time for both committees to question the former special counsel, officials said. "We are pleased to announce that special counsel Mueller will provide additional public testimony when he appears before our committees," the committee chairmen said in a joint statement.
